I'm sure many of you have had your power steering belt squeal at some point... I replaced it about a year ago and I end up having to tighten it periodically because the squeal just keeps coming back. Obviously, its worse in the cold and only noticeable when the engine is cold. Have any of you solved this problem once and for all? (obviously still replacing it every few years) Tightening and tightening just seems like it will lead to a snapped belt and loss of power steering. Any suggestions?

Check pulley for true run. Flat blade screwdriver while running. You're smart enough not to lose a finger.

Remove belt and clean the grooves out of the pulley.

Make sure the pump isn't getting hot. If the pulley is dragging or the fluid is cherry Kool-aid red.

i fixed mine yesterday, i had the steering not turning freely with my belts slackness as well. i loosened off the nut under the alternator and raised the alternator up some. squeak gone !
